2013/776/EU: Commission Implementing Decision of 18 December 2013 establishing the ‘Education, Audiovisual and Culture Executive Agency’ and repealing Decision 2009/336/EC

OJ L 343, 19.12.2013, p. 46–53 (BG, ES, CS, DA, DE, ET, EL, EN, FR, HR, IT, LV, LT, HU, MT, NL, PL, PT, RO, SK, SL, FI, SV)

Legal status of the document No longer in force, Date of end of validity: 31/03/2021; Repealed by 32021D0173

THE EUROPEAN COMMISSION,

Having regard to the Treaty on the Functioning of the European Union,

Having regard to Council Regulation (EC) No 58/2003 of 19 December 2002 laying down the statute for executive agencies to be entrusted with certain tasks in the management of Community programmes (1), and in particular Article 3 thereof,

Whereas:

(1)

Regulation (EC) No 58/2003 empowers the Commission to delegate powers to the executive agencies to implement all or part of a Union programme or project, on its behalf and under its responsibility, in accordance with that Regulation.

(2)

The purpose of entrusting the executive agencies with programme implementation tasks is to enable the Commission to focus on its core activities and functions which cannot be outsourced, without relinquishing control over, and ultimate responsibility for, activities managed by those executive agencies.

(3)

The delegation of tasks related to programme implementation to an executive agency requires a clear separation between the programming stages involving a large measure of discretion in making choices driven by policy considerations, this being carried out by the Commission, and programme implementation, which should be entrusted to the executive agency.

(4)

By Decision 2005/56/EC (2), the Commission created the Education, Audiovisual and Culture Executive Agency (hereinafter referred to as the Agency) and entrusted it with the management of Community actions in the field of education, audiovisual and culture.

(5)

The Commission amended the Agency’s mandate on several occasions, extending it to cover the management of new projects and programmes in the field of education, audiovisual, citizenship and youth and subsequently replaced Decision 2005/56/EC by Commission Decision 2009/336/EC (3).

(6)

In its Communication of 29 June 2011‘A budget for Europe 2020’ (4), the Commission proposed to use the option of more extensive recourse to existing executive agencies for the implementation of Union programmes in the next multiannual financial framework.

(7)

The Agency has demonstrated a high level technical and financial expertise in the management of Union programmes. Satisfaction surveys conducted as part of the first and second interim evaluations of EACEA (2009 and 2013) show that beneficiaries and other stakeholders believe that EACEA delivers a better quality of service as compared to previous arrangements (Technical Assistance Office). EACEA is able to attract and retain highly qualified personnel, which in turn provides staffing stability. The Agency continuously streamlines its internal operations to improve its efficiency and seeks to standardise approaches across programmes. It benefits from its status as a public body specifically created to manage programmes in the area of education, audiovisual and culture and this focus enhances the visibility of the EU programmes among stakeholders and the general public. The existence of a single entity managing a number of complementary programmes generates synergy effects in terms of visibility of EU action to the mutual benefit of all programmes. The ex-post control error rates are low for EACEA and well below the limit of 2 %. The second interim evaluation notes a steady improvement in EACEA’s technical and financial expertise which in turn is reflected in a general improvement in the Agency’s performance as observed in its KPIs.

(8)

In terms of the cost comparison with the ‘in-house option’, the cost-benefit analysis carried out in accordance with Article 3(1) of Regulation (EC) No 58/2003 found it would be more costly to manage the tasks at the Commission, by a margin of 23 % in net present value terms. The new programmes envisaged for delegation to EACEA are in line with the Agency’s current mandate and mission and represent a continuation of its existing activities. The Agency has built up competence, skills and capacity in the management of these programmes over several years. The new programmes would therefore benefit from EACEA’s accumulated experience and expertise in programme management, and resultant productivity gains. A shift to an in-house arrangement would be disruptive as most programmes have never been managed internally by the parent DGs, which lack the capacity to manage programmes in-house. Delegation of programme management to EACEA would thus ensure business continuity for programme beneficiaries and stakeholders. Delegation to EACEA will also continue to allow the Commission to better focus on its institutional tasks.

(9)

In order to give executive agencies a coherent identity, the Commission has, as far as possible, grouped work by thematic policy area in establishing their new mandates.

(10)

The Agency should be made responsible for implementing parts of the following new Union programmes and actions:

Erasmus+ (5); (successor to Lifelong Learning Programme (6), Youth in Action (7) and Erasmus Mundus (8), among others),

Creative Europe (9); (successor to the Media (10) and Culture (11) programmes, among others),

Europe for Citizens (12) (successor to the Europe for Citizens programme (13)),

EU Aid Volunteers (14) (successor to pilot programme Preparatory action — European Voluntary Humanitarian Aid Corps),

projects in the field of higher education falling under external cooperation instruments (15) (successor to external cooperation instruments to 2013 (16)),

projects in the field of higher education under the multiannual financial framework regarding the financing of EU cooperation for African, Caribbean and Pacific States and Overseas Countries and Territories for the 2014-2020 period (11th European Development Fund) (17).

(12)

Management of those parts of these programmes and actions involves implementation of technical projects which do not entail political decision-making and requires a high level of technical and financial expertise throughout the project cycle.

(13)

In order to ensure a consistent implementation in time of this Decision and of the programmes concerned, it is necessary to ensure that the Agency shall exercise its tasks linked to the implementation of those programmes subject to and from the date on which those programmes enter into force.

(14)

The Education, Audiovisual and Culture Executive Agency should be established. It should replace and succeed the Education, Audiovisual and Culture Executive Agency established by Decision 2009/336/EC. It should operate in accordance with the general statute laid down by Regulation (EC) No 58/2003.

(15)

Decision 2009/336/EC setting up the executive agency should be repealed and transitional provisions should be set out.

(16)

The measures provided for by this Decision are in accordance with the opinion of the Committee for Executive Agencies,

HAS ADOPTED THIS DECISION:

Article 1

Establishment and term

The Education, Audiovisual and Culture Executive Agency (hereinafter referred to as the Agency) is hereby established for a period from 1 January 2014 until 31 December 2024, its statute being governed by Regulation (EC) No 58/2003.

Article 2

Location

The Agency shall be located in Brussels.

Article 3

Objectives and tasks

1.   The Agency is hereby entrusted with the implementation of certain parts of the following Union programmes:

3.   The Agency shall be responsible for the following tasks related to the implementation of the parts of the Union programmes referred to in paragraphs 1 and 2:

(a)

managing all stages of programme implementation and all phases in the lifetime of specific projects on the basis of the relevant work programmes adopted by the Commission, where the Commission has empowered it to do so in the instrument of delegation;

(b)

adopting the instruments of budget execution for revenue and expenditure and carrying out all the operations necessary for the management of the programme, where the Commission has empowered it to do so in the instrument of delegation;

(c)

providing support in programme implementation where the Commission has empowered it to do so in the instrument of delegation, including support in dissemination activities, where relevant in cooperation with national agencies;

(d)

the implementation, at Union level, of the network of information on education in Europe (Eurydice) and activities intended to improve understanding and knowledge of the field of youth;

(e)

the implementation, at Union level, of activities intended to improve understanding and knowledge in the field of vocational education and training.

4.   The Agency may be responsible for the provision of administrative and logistical support services if provided in the instrument of delegation, for the benefit of the programme-implementing bodies and within the scope of the programmes referred to therein.

Article 4

Duration of the appointments

1.   The members of the Steering Committee shall be appointed for two years.

2.   The Director shall be appointed for four years.

Article 5

Supervision and reporting requirement

The Agency shall be subject to supervision by the Commission and shall report regularly on progress in implementing the Union programmes or parts thereof for which it is responsible in accordance with the arrangements and at the intervals stipulated in the instrument of delegation.

Article 6

Implementation of the operating budget

The Agency shall implement its operating budget in accordance with the provisions of Commission Regulation (EC) No 1653/2004 (60).

Article 7

Repeal and transitional provisions

1.   Decision 2009/336/EC is repealed with effect from 1 January 2014. References to the repealed Decision shall be construed as references to this Decision.

2.   The Agency shall be considered the legal successor of the executive agency established by Decision 2009/336/EC.

3.   Without prejudice to the revision of the grading of seconded officials foreseen by the instrument of delegation, this Decision shall not affect the rights and obligations of staff employed by the Agency, including its Director.

Article 8

Entry into force

This Decision shall enter into force on the day following that of its publication in the Official Journal of the European Union.

It shall apply from 1 January 2014.
